基于阈值化分割与小波变换的彩色数字水印算法

摘    要:文中提出1种根据灰度特征对水印图像进行阈值化分割,然后分别嵌入到原始图像小波变换后的低频及中频系数,并根据视觉系统的照度掩蔽等特性实现嵌入强度自适应调节的彩色数字水印新算法。由于通过阈值化分割把水印各像素按不同的幅度进行分类以适应低频系数和中频系数对鲁棒性和透明性的要求,该算法能够很好地解决水印的鲁棒性和透明性这对矛盾,使得水印的鲁棒性和透明性达到优化的效果。

Abstract:This article presents a new algorithm of colorized digital watermarking based on threshold division and wavelet transformation which also adaptively adjusts the intensity of embed watermarking determined by the characteristics of the human vision system. Based on threshold division, we divide the watermarking into two partition of different intension in order to adapt to the invisibility and robustness characterized by the low and medium frequency bands. The proposed algorithm smoothly solved the contradict problem between robustness and crystal of watermarking.
